The DDS Statewide Advisory Council (SAC) meets at least quarterly to advise the Commissioner on policy, program development, and priorities for DDS services and supports.

By regulation 115CMR 3.02 (5)(a), the Statewide Advisory Council is appointed by the Secretary of Health and Human Services and approved by the Governor.

What is the Statewide Advisory Council (SAC)?

DDS has groups called Citizen Advisory Boards (CAB) across the state, as well as a Statewide Advisory Council (SAC). CABs and the SAC work to make things better for people with disabilities.

CABs and the SAC include people who have disabilities, family members, caregivers, professionals, and other community members.

Members give advice to the DDS Commissioner about what the community needs and how to improve DDS programs and services. They also help by talking to lawmakers and teaching the community about disabilities.
